CJ Hole are delighted to welcome to the sales market this beautifully presented, three bedroom, terraced home in Arnos Vale with NO ONWARD CHAIN.

Positioned perfectly between Brislington and the city centre, next to cycle tracks and on main bus routes this property is set on a quiet No-through-road and is very well presented throughout, offering spacious living, with two reception rooms, three bedrooms, large downstairs bathroom and modern kitchen.
On the ground floor there are two reception rooms. The main living room features a large bay window and retains some original features along with new bespoke carpentry shelving and storage and the large dining room offers plenty of storage and space. Both reception rooms and hallway have had flooring renovations to reveal the beautiful original wood.
The kitchen is spacious with plentiful storage and access to rear garden, whilst the bathroom features separate bath and walk-in shower.
The first floor is home to three well-proportioned bedrooms. The Master bedroom is very large, featuring a bay window and separate side window, giving fantastic natural light.
All bedrooms are decorated to a good standard with recent plasterwork in main and 2nd bedroom to some walls, with both ceilings newly boarded & decorated. The rear bedroom, currently used as a home office, also benefits from recent wall and ceiling insulation
Outside
The large & unique garden, with it’s sunken area, Indian sandstone patio and various decked and gravelled areas is a treat for those looking for outside space – large gardens like this are rare so close to the centre.
Locally there are extensive amenities available without needing a car, such as Sandy Park Road high street with bakeries, cafe's, pubs & more, and the fantastic BocaBar. Green spaces are a short walk away, such as Victoria Park, Perrett Park & Arnos Court Park whilst the beautiful Arnos Vale Victorian Cemetery is only 2 minutes walk.
The City Centre is easily accessible by foot or bicycle via riverside cycle path & Temple Meads is only a 15 minute walk – great for commuting.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on May 19, 2023

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on May 19, 2023

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
